Skip to main content Login Support Back English/US Deutsch English/AU & NZ English/UK Français Español/Europa Español/América Latina 繁體中文 … WebIn the closed-ended version, respondents were provided five options and could volunteer an option not on the list. When explicitly offered the economy as a response, more than half of respondents (58%) chose this answer; only 35% of those who responded to the open-ended version volunteered the economy.
